I'm just going to come right out and say it, once and for all. Mumford and Sons new album, Babel is not nearly as good as their first album, Sigh No More. I was in denial about it until last night, when a song from Sigh No More came up on a mix I was playing. It was then that I realized the severe disappointment I have in Babel. I've listened to it several times, telling myself that I love them and that they make fantastic music but for some reason, I just couldn't get into this album like I did with the other.
It's not bad music. It's still good. But I think because their first album was somewhat mind-blowing, this one is much more disappointing. It's like Vampire Weekend. Their first album was one of those albums you can't choose a favorite song from. Then their second album Contra was good, had a couple hits but, in comparison, there was no comparison.
I never know what to do when this happens to bands. I feel bad for them almost. Did they just get lucky with their first album? Was it a fluke? Are they really not as talented as we thought? Or did they just get intimidated by what they created first and panicked with the next? Like people who are bad test takers? They study and know everything but once the pressure is on, they fail? I don't know. I guess only time will tell. I'll keep an eye on Mumford and Sons. I'm curious to see what happens next.
